Transaction 823f496ec94a1304101c8acc2359311993663612364c33e2236b80fc4637e655

1 Input
2 Outputs
  • 823f496ec94a1304101c8acc2359311993663612364c33e2236b80fc4637e655:0
  • value  28667
    address  1PfDfKdDKPfHNSzyRNQVgN3PAeCgU4HJiM
  • 823f496ec94a1304101c8acc2359311993663612364c33e2236b80fc4637e655:1
  • value  152207
    address  1emASegSt78EfbinNpRbX36mBnubWy3ki